New law could remove 22 percent of Arizona construction trade workers
The new Legal Arizona Workers Act, effective Jan. 1, 2008, inflicts strict penalties on businesses employing illegal immigrants. Widely viewed as the toughest crackdown on illegal immigration in the country, penalties include a 10-day suspension of the company’s business license for the first offense and a complete loss of the license for a second offense. According to a University of Arizona study, illegal immigrants account for 10 percent of Arizona’s workforce and 22 percent of the state’s construction workforce … read more
Aluminum door manufacturer will move to green building in 2008
Exact Finish Inc., a Kernersville, N.C. manufacturer of aluminum doors, will build a sustainable manufacturing facility and increase its workforce by the end of this year. The new building will be about 35,000 square feet with a goal to obtain platinum Leadership in Energy and Environmental Design certification. The plant will likely be in High Point or Greensboro, N.C., and cost between $2.2 million and $3 million … read more
